When I got a parking ticket for parking in the street from vehicle control services I contacted the free legal advice I get from my union. They were really helpful and I was completely reassured that I could ignore the letters with confidence. My advice is to make the most of the free legal services out there, car insurance companies often give legal advice, especially if legal fees are included in your policy. Plus most solicitors provide 30 mins free legal advice, my phone call took 10 mins to fully reassure me I could ignore the letters!0
